可以的。RS485接口进来的信号,一般是MODBUS协议,此时PLC自动识别,因为都是支持的。也可能是自编协议,这个要看你的传感器说明书或询问厂家,如果是自编协议,要根据PLC手册修改程序进行接 受转换。若想提高通讯稳定性,物理层可以选用POWERSBUS透传,数据子自下到上,到了PLC再转成485。
选带以太网的PLC,AB .ABB,西门子,三菱的都有,最好是无线的路由器,与笔记本连接不用接线,调试方便。
买周立功的串口服务器,与PC是以太网,与PLC是485通讯;
根据成本你自己选择吧。
也可以选带以太网的触摸屏,经过触摸屏的网口与电脑连。
现在做一个项目,需求是这样的,因为部分计算任务比较复杂,PLC难以完成,希望借助PC来实现;因此,需要PLC与PC之间做通讯,由PLC上传数据给PC,然后PC对数据进行处理,最后再从PC发回给PLC。因为PLC选了315-2PN/DP,希望基于以太网通讯。另外,因为PC上的处理程序需要调用外部的C++库,希望基于C++实现程序。我的问题是:针对上面的情况,可以选择什么方式来实现PLC与PC的通讯(要求实时性好),希望最好有可供参考的示例或代码?诚心求教,非常感谢!
欢迎分享,转载请注明来源:夏雨云
评论列表(0条)